User Reviews
Pros
- Robust inventory and tracking of LEGO sets and individual parts, helping you catalog and keep counts.
- Effectively surfaces missing pieces and helps manage gaps across multiple sets.
- Saves time and streamlines sorting and gathering pieces, including when sourcing from bulk bins.
- Ongoing improvements and revamps, with patches addressing issues.
- Widely useful for recovering old sets, planning builds, and discovering what you can build next.
Cons
- No global missing-parts view across all sets, and lack of an import/export or cross-device backup for missing parts.
- Data persistence issues: crashes when opening set lists and occasional search errors; risk of data loss without backup.
- UI/UX can feel outdated and navigation can be awkward for large sets.
- Cannot easily view the individual parts of a set from the set search; limited per-set detail and a need for better set-piece access.
- Missing features like a notes field and advanced list synchronization (import/export, piece counts, error reporting) as requested by users.

Loved it until they locked exporting lists behind a subscription. Probably would've done a one-time fee, but I'm not paying $3/mo (or whatever it is). Edit: I appreciate your (devs) (quick) response to my rating. I understand the pricing is probably reasonable. However, I don't use the app (or my Legos) enough to justify paying a monthly fee. I may catalog one set, then forget about it for 6 months before another. Paying a subscription doesn't make sense for a couple hours of use a month.
